Per the latest report by Bloomberg media which cited a source familiar to the matter, said that Facebook is determining the possible meeting between congressional committee and its chief operating officer (COO) Sheryl Sandberg to testify the stance of Libra as soon as next month.

Facebook Seeks Sheryl Sandberg Hearing Testimony

As Facebook’s Libra is over-weighed with the regulatory uncertainties from the global regulators, the social media giant strongly urged to clear all those regulatory hurdles from its path prior to launching Libra cryptocurrency. Although it was set to launch in the year 2020 as per its earlier announcement, the CEO Mark Zuckerberg fails to commit the launch date in his latest interview with the Nikkie Asia.

Per the Bloomberg’s latest report, Facebook’s COO Sandberg seeks to testify to the US House Financial Service Committee as soon as late October but this may be postponed to later in the year. Accordingly, the COO might address various questions concerning the possible risk that the global monetary system could face with the launch of Libra.

Undoubtedly, Facebook’s announcement of launching Libra raised the eyebrows of global regulators, policymakers, central banks and almost all high-profiles that work closely with government and central banks. Among other countries, the stance of the US over Libra consider as the serious roadblock since the US President Donald Trump publicly bashed at the giant’s plan of entering into the financial world. With the close scrutiny of the matter, it was assumed that United States believe Libra’s entry into the financial world could be a direct threat to US Dollar as the Dollar is the global currency at present for various aspects including international trades.

In fact, Mark Carney, the governor of Bank of England suggested central banks should have the reserve in stablecoins such as Facebook’s Libra. Importantly, he mentioned, Libra will be one approach that might end the dominance of the US Dollar.

Conclusively,  Sheryl Sandberg isn’t the first officials to be testifying Libra in US house, previously in July, the Calibra CEO David Marcus testified against both the House and the Senate. Although committee members posed hard questions, the hearing was concluded with no solid decision, demanding Mark Zuckerberg’s presence in the house.
